Solution for 0.5(y+1)=9 equation:


Simplifying
0.5(y + 1) = 9

Reorder the terms:
0.5(1 + y) = 9
(1 * 0.5 + y * 0.5) = 9
(0.5 + 0.5y) = 9

Solving
0.5 + 0.5y = 9

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-0.5' to each side of the equation.
0.5 + -0.5 + 0.5y = 9 + -0.5

Combine like terms: 0.5 + -0.5 = 0.0
0.0 + 0.5y = 9 + -0.5
0.5y = 9 + -0.5

Combine like terms: 9 + -0.5 = 8.5
0.5y = 8.5

Divide each side by '0.5'.
y = 17

Simplifying
y = 17
